项目摘要
Small Modular Reactors (SMRs) have been identified as a key strategic area of research and development byNatural Resources Canada, which released a detailed SMR Roadmap in November 2018. Two proposed rolesfor SMRs are in remote communities, and mining and oil/gas sites. In these types of applications, no traditionalpower grid is present, and often renewable energy resources also constitute desirable sources of energy. Toensure the safe and reliable operation of SMRs in conjunction with diverse types of renewable energy systemsin an off-grid environment, it is important that we have reliable and robust Instrumentation & Control (I&C)systems. Instrumentation & control systems are the brain and nervous systems for SMRs, and also enable theintegration and operation with other types of energy systems to form a microgrid. In the previous three terms ofthe NSERC/UNENE Industrial Research Chair (IRC) program, Dr. Jin Jiang has excelled in the areas ofmodeling, control, and wireless technologies for performance monitoring for nuclear power plants. He has alsoestablished a strong research program in microgrids based on renewable energy resources. Two state-of-the-artlabs are established to support research in these fields. The goal of the research in the fourth term of this IRCprogram is to further leverage the experience gained, and the infrastructure established, over the last 15 years tocarry out much needed research on I&C for SMRs and the integration of SMRs into renewable energymicrogrids, and to continue training of HQPs for Canadian industry by developing their leadership qualitiesand innovation skills.The proposed research is divided into three themes: (1) Control & Operation of SMRs; (2) Monitoring ofHealth and Operating Status of SMRs; and (3) Integration of SMRs with Different Energy Sources in off-gridMicrogrids. Under each theme, there are 3 projects. It is expected that the research will make significantoriginal contributions in this strategic area for Canada and will also train 18 HQPs over the next 5 years.
